XHDA A4 Part Dividers (1–20) – 5 Pack Multi-Colour PP Plastic Index Tabs for 11-Hole Ring Binders
Product description
What these A4 part dividers are for
If your A4 documents routinely turn into a pile of “I’ll sort it later”, these XHDA A4 part dividers are designed to fix that. They’re essentially subject/index tabs for ring binders, letting you split a single A4 file into clearly separated sections. The set includes a writable catalog page plus 20 distinguishable coloured tag pages, so you can label each section and find what you need without digging.
On paper, this is a straightforward add-on for study notes, workplace documents and anything you file regularly. The multi-colour approach is meant to make sections visually recognisable at a glance—useful when you’re flipping between topics during a busy week.
That said, they’re not a replacement for a proper filing system if your folder is already chaos. They help you structure what you already have, but they can’t solve bad habits like not labelling in the first place.

Key features that matter in daily use
The design is built around two practical ideas: clear separation and easy loading into the right binder style.
The A4 divider size is listed as 8.86×11.81in, and the pack is made from PP plastic with a slightly textured surface. According to the description, the material is waterproof and durable, and not easy to deform and tear—so they’re intended to stand up to everyday handling rather than turning flimsy after a few weeks.
The tabs cover 20 sections (label pages), which is where this set is most useful. If you tend to keep a folder for one subject or one workflow (for example, a set of meeting documents or course notes), having more than a handful of parts can make the divider system feel genuinely functional instead of overkill.



A small note worth keeping in mind: since these are plastic dividers, they’re likely to be better suited to frequent re-filing and wipe-clean environments than to anything that requires a super-soft or paper-like feel.
Compatibility: will they fit your binder?
These dividers come pre-punched with 11 holes, designed to fit “most” 2/3/4/11 ring binders. If your current binder uses 11-hole layouts (or one of the ring counts mentioned), they should load in without drama.
However, if your binder is a different punching format (for example, a smaller set of rings or an unusual hole pattern), you may need to check carefully before committing. The description is clear about 11-hole alignment, but it doesn’t cover every binder type on the market.
